Considering the weather, choose a day when you are fairly sure you will need the heater. Schedule a parent involvement activity during the part of the day when the smell is typically at its worst. Before that day take all of the potporri, air freshener, etc. out of your room. (You are not responsible for providing that and you should not have to spend your own money on it.) Make sure the activity lasts long enough for the parents to really get an idea of how bad it is. When they bring it up, explain that you have asked to have it looked at and that maintance came but will not be able to do anything at this time. Beyond this, refer questions to the principal. In fact, you might wish to ask the principal to participate in the activity in some way.
